WhatsApp continues to refine its user experience with a fresh update now in the works. The instant messaging platform is currently testing a new feature for its artificial intelligence chatbot, MetaAI. This upcoming enhancement will enable users to send voice messages to the chatbot, which currently only responds in text. The feature is being introduced to a select group of beta testers initially, with plans to potentially roll it out more widely in the coming weeks.

According to WABetaInfo, a WhatsApp feature tracker, the new voice message feature for MetaAI has been spotted in the WhatsApp beta for Android version 2.24.16.10. Once fully rolled out, users in the Google Play Beta program will be able to tap the MetaAI button to enter the chat interface, where a new voice message icon will be added.
This icon, which resembles those used in other chats and groups, will be located next to the text field at the bottom of the screen. This update will allow users to send voice messages to MetaAI, which will process the audio, understand the query, and respond in text form.
The feature will be particularly useful for users who prefer speaking over typing long questions, making it ideal for those on the go. While MetaAI has been able to generate images, it has not previously handled audio. This update marks a significant expansion of its capabilities.
